The Wellington Harbour Ferries Company announces that' the offices of the Company have been removed to Wood's Building (ground floor), corner of Waterloo Quay and Ballance Street, opposite the Custom House.

Messrs. MacdonaJd, "Wilson and Co. have' the following: announcements appearing in our auction columns:—Under instructions from the Evans Bay and Miramar Estato Company, at tho Exchange Land Mart of the firm, on March 18, at 7.30 o'clock, tho balance of unsold sections, numbering forty-three, and ranging in area from half an acre to two acres each, will be sold. ' Tho sections consist of flat and undulating land, easy of access, and fronting well-made streets in close proximity thff tramway service. Liberal terms of sale are announced, and plans may bo obtained from the auctioneers. Tho sale is . a final , one, in order ■to close up tho Company's estate. By order of tho Wellington and Manawatu Railway Company, will be sold, on March it), n valuable block of land, containing 5 acres 1 rood 20 perches, situate on tho Company's lino within a rrfilo ana a half irotc the P.ir.v paraurau Railway Station, and ■ having a long frontage to the Main Koad. Plans may be jseeo. it Wis ai;ction£oia' offices.
